Clarksville native, celebrated outdoorsman Wade Bourne dies

In Case You Missed it: Clarksville native and well-known outdoorsman Wade Bourne passed away Thursday, Dec. 15. Ducks Unlimited announced Bourne’s passing on their Facebook page: “It is with profound sorrow that we announce the loss of a friend, mentor, conservationist, waterfowler, and member of the Ducks Unlimited family. Wade Bourne, editor-at-large of Ducks Unlimited magazine, co-host of DU TV, and a frequent contributor to our website, passed away unexpectedly yesterday evening at his home in Clarksville, Tennessee.
